Wavy Hair Don’t Care! (And a Couple of New Hair Products From L’Oreal)

January 31st, 2014 by Karen 17 Comments

After trying a couple of new products from L’Oreal and letting ye olde mop (also known as my naturally wavy hair) air dry, this was the result…

First thing I tried was the new L’Oreal Color Vibrancy Instant Shock Treatment ($7). L’Oreal calls it a “lightweight melting mask,” and it’s designed to add shine and moisture to color-treated hair.

It’s pretty neat.

It’s a conditioner, so you use it after shampoo. Here’s the kicker: when you work it through your hair, it doesn’t feel like it’s coating the strands, but instead like it’s melting right into them. Can’t say I’ve ever tried anything quite like it before… Really cool.

After I got out of the shower and towel dried my hair, I applied about four pumps of the new L’Oreal Curve It Curl Taming Creme ($5) to it. It added soft definition to my waves without leaving them crunchy or weighed down. I like how my hair looks with this stuff — slightly wild, but not too wild, LOL! Thumbs up.

Wavy hair don’t care! 🙂

Both products are available now at drugstores, Ulta and ulta.com.
